  1. Boston,Massachusetts
    With street patterns owing to 17th-century London, Boston, "America's Walking City" and home of the original tea party, is a beautiful city full of historic sites. From Bunker Hill to the U.S.S. Constitution, this gateway to New England boasts many famous places to visit. Boston has some of the most well preserved historic buildings in the country, and is compact enough so that you can see them all on foot. Optional shore excursions include a Freedom Trail Walking Tour, a trip to Salem and the Witch Museum and even the John F. Kennedy Library. (All meals on board)

  1. Saint John,New Brunswick
    Located on the Bay of Fundy, Saint John is home to the highest tides in the world. With a billion tons of water moving in and out of the bay twice a day, Saint John is home to numerous sea caves, cliffs, fascinating marine life and an incredible reversing waterfall. With shore excursions ranging from beachcombing and riding the rapids, to visiting the Cape d'Or Lighthouse, there's something amazing for everyone to do in Saint John. (All meals on board)

  1. Halifax,Nova Scotia
    Hundreds of miles of incredible coastline with majestic scenery from end to end qualifies Halifax as perhaps one of the most beautiful capital cities in the world. 2012 marks the 100th anniversary of the Titanic disaster, and Halifax played an important role in the rescue of survivors and burial of victims. There's plenty to see in Halifax and shore excursions can help you explore the many galleries and museums, historic sites and colorful gardens. You may wish to take an optional shore excursion to Peggy’s Cove, often called the world’s most beautiful fishing village, or set sail aboard a historic and elegant tall ship for an adventure you’ll never forget.
